Description
The Taylors and Company 1873 Cattleman is a single-action revolver chambered in .357 Magnum, built on the classic 1873 pattern that defined the Old West. It works just as well for cowboy action shooting as it does sitting in a collection.

Detailed Features
The exposed hammer gives you full control over each shot, and the blade-front/notch-rear sight combo is straightforward to use. The color case-hardened frame is the visual highlight of this gun — the mottled colors come from the traditional hardening process and hold up well to regular use.
At 2.35 lbs it balances easily in hand. The imitation stag grip fits the period aesthetic and provides a secure hold without being slippery.
Usage Scenarios
Cowboy action shooters will appreciate the quick-draw geometry and .357 Mag chambering, which also accepts .38 Special for lighter practice loads. It's equally at home in a display case for anyone who collects historical-pattern firearms.
